How much do freelance creative project man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for freelance creative project manager in Minnesota is $94,648.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$80,300.00 and $108,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a freelance creative project manager?

To thrive as a Freelance Creative Project Manager, you need expertise in project planning, creative workflow management, and client communications, often backed by experience or qualifications in marketing, design, or related fields. Familiarity with project management software like Asana, Trello, or Monday.com, as well as design collaboration tools such as Adobe Creative Cloud or Figma, is typically required. Outstanding organizational skills, adaptability, and the ability to build relationships with diverse creative teams are crucial soft skills. These competencies enable smooth project execution, effective client service, and successful delivery of creative projects in fast-paced, multi-client environments.

What are some common challenges faced by freelance creative project managers, and how can they be addressed?

As a Freelance Creative Project Manager, you may encounter challenges such as balancing multiple client projects simultaneously, managing remote or cross-functional creative teams, and ensuring clear communication despite differing stakeholder expectations. Time management and setting clear project milestones become essential to keeping deliverables on track. Building strong client relationships and proactively addressing feedback can help streamline workflows and reduce revisions. Adopting flexible project management techniques and leveraging collaboration tools are effective strategies for overcoming these challenges and delivering successful outcomes.

What is a freelance creative project manager?

A Freelance Creative Project Manager oversees and coordinates creative projects on a contractual basis, ensuring they are completed on time, within budget, and meet client expectations. They collaborate with designers, writers, marketers, and other creatives to streamline workflows, manage resources, and resolve any challenges. Unlike in-house project managers, freelancers work with multiple clients and industries, adapting to different team dynamics and project scopes. Their role requires str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ills to effectively manage deadlines and deliverables.

The Impact You'll Make in this Role
As a Project Manager, you will have the opportunity to tap into your curiosity and collaborate with some of the most innovative people around the world. Here, you will make an impact by:
  • Leading a cross-functional team of scientists, engineers, and business personnel to define areas of opportunity, value proposition, technical approaches, intellectual property, and manufacturing options ultimately leading to successful commercialization.
  • Being accountable for maintaining project schedule, scope, deliverables, budget, risk management, stakeholder/customer communication and approvals, and other key project deliverables.
  • Providing task-level guidance to team members as necessary and using influence to lead the team in identifying key milestones and driving decisions to closure.
  • Having expertise in technical functional areas sufficient to carry out leadership duties, contribute to advancement of the team, and to effectively leverage a network of company resources.
  • Training, coaching, and supporting project leaders and team members in project management best practices, while helping strengthen project management capability across the business.

Your Skills and Expertise
To set you up for success in this role from day one, 3M requires (at a minimum) the following q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ree or higher (completed and verified prior to start) from an accredited institution
  • Eight (8) years of project management and/or team leadership experience in a private, public, government or military environment

Additional qualifications that could help you succeed even further in this role include:
  • Bachelor's degree or higher in an Engineering or Science discipline from an accredited institution
  • New product development experience
  • Experience with New Product Introduction Process and Executing Gate Reviews
  • Consumer product development experience
  • Excellent communication skills (oral, written and presentation)
  • Ability to influence including clarifying risks and opportunities with stakeholders
  • Experience leading global cross-functional teams
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and Project
  • Project Management Institute's Project Management Professional (PMP) certification
